Divers find missing 15-year-old's body in Trinity River

Divers found the body of a missing 15-year-old boy who reportedly fell into the Trinity River.

Search crews and dive teams returned to the scene near Downtown Fort Worth Friday morning. The teen reportedly fell into the water there while fishing just after 6 p.m. Thursday.

Authorities said the boy was not alone. He was out with a relative who tried to go after him.

Witnesses saw the teen and the relative struggling. They said the relative was able to make it out of the water but the teen couldn't. The relative jumped in again as others called 911.

"He tried going back into the water to look for him. They were screaming his name and nothing showed," said Lesly Garcia, a witness. "They chased him over there to see if they could see a sign or anything, but no."

Firefighters were out Thursday evening with multiple dive teams looking at the scene and down stream. Rescuers were also going up and down the banks on foot.

Family members at the scene were visibly very upset as crews searched for hours. They found no sign of him until Friday morning.

Rescuers said the teen was not wearing a life vest at the time.
